 US works to recover debris, intel from downed Chinese ‘spy’ balloon
by Julia Shapero - 02/04/23 9:36 PM ET

The U.S. military is working to recover debris and intelligence information from a Chinese “spy” balloon that was shot down off the coast of South Carolina on Saturday.

The U.S. Navy and Coast Guard are working to establish a perimeter around where the balloon fell into the Atlantic Ocean and is searching for debris, a senior defense official said. The search is expected to be “fairly easy,” given that the balloon was shot down in a shallow area, the official said in a statement.

The surveillance balloon went down about six miles off the Carolina coast in about 47 feet of water, after an F-22 fighter fired one missile at the balloon, according to the Air Force press release.

However, despite falling in relatively shallow water, the official said there is no estimate for how long it will take to recover the debris.

 February 5, 2023 2:23pm EST
Navy divers working to recover China spy balloon debris with Coast Guard, Navy ships on site
The US shot down the balloon less than 12 miles off the South Carolina coast
By Anders Hagstrom | Fox News

 Navy divers are working to recover debris from the suspected Chinese spy balloon the U.S. shot down off the coast of South Carolina on Saturday.

U.S. Navy and Coast Guard ships arrived to the site where the balloon hit the water on Saturday before establishing a perimeter around the area. Pentagon officials say the recovery effort is expected to be relatively easy thanks to the shallow depth of just under 50 feet, but it could still take days.

The U.S. military had put several vessels from the Navy and Coast Guard on alert prior to shooting down the balloon. Recovery efforts began later Saturday and continue Sunday, with divers facing few obstacles aside from cold water temperatures, according to the New York Times.

Defense Secretary Lloyd Austin said in a statement that the balloon, which was being used to surveil "strategic sites" in the U.S., was an "unacceptable violation of our sovereignty." President Biden ordered the balloon shot down last week, but the military waited until the craft was over open water.
